How AI-Powered Tutoring Platforms Work

AI-powered tutoring platforms use machine learning algorithms to analyze vast amounts of data and adapt to individual learning styles. These platforms can provide real-time feedback and guidance, helping students to learn more effectively and efficiently.

The Benefits of AI-Powered Tutoring

The benefits of AI-powered tutoring are numerous, ranging from improved academic performance to increased student engagement. By providing personalized learning experiences, AI-powered tutoring platforms can help students to develop a deeper understanding of complex subjects and improve their overall educational outcomes.

The Challenges of Implementing AI-Powered Tutoring

While AI-powered tutoring has the potential to transform the education sector, there are also challenges associated with its implementation. These range from ensuring equity of access to addressing concerns around bias and accountability.

How to apply it today

To get started with AI-powered tutoring, educators can explore platforms such as DreamBox or Carnegie Learning, which offer AI-driven math and reading programs. These platforms can be integrated into existing curricula, providing students with personalized learning experiences that are tailored to their individual needs.

For instance, a student struggling with algebra can use an AI-powered tutoring platform to receive real-time feedback and guidance on their math problems. The platform can analyze the student's strengths and weaknesses, providing targeted support and recommendations for improvement.
